summaryrefslogtreecommitdiffstats
path: root/Graphic_Equalizer/src/main.hcc
diff options
context:
space:
mode:
Diffstat (limited to 'Graphic_Equalizer/src/main.hcc')
-rw-r--r--Graphic_Equalizer/src/main.hcc7
1 files changed, 4 insertions, 3 deletions
diff --git a/Graphic_Equalizer/src/main.hcc b/Graphic_Equalizer/src/main.hcc
index 9c18ca5..60eb71b 100644
--- a/Graphic_Equalizer/src/main.hcc
+++ b/Graphic_Equalizer/src/main.hcc
@@ -60,6 +60,7 @@ void main(void) {
mousedata_t mousedata;
events_t events;
+ mpram equalizer_levels_t equalizer_levels;
unsigned 1 result;
/*
@@ -123,7 +124,7 @@ void main(void) {
display_init(ClockRate);
PalAudioInEnable(AudioIn);
PalAudioOutEnable(AudioOut);
- audio_init(6, LINE_IN, SR_44100);
+ audio_init(6, LINE_IN, SR_44100, AudioIn, AudioOut);
#if HAVE_SMARTMEDIA
/*
* Once we properly setup the SmartMedia we load our
@@ -154,8 +155,8 @@ void main(void) {
*/
mouse_main(mousedata);
display_main(events, mousedata, ClockRate, VideoOut, RAM_BANK0);
- eventhandler_main(events, mousedata);
- audio_main();
+ eventhandler_main(equalizer_levels, events, mousedata);
+ audio_main(AudioIn, AudioOut);
}
#if HAVE_SMARTMEDIA
} else {